Abstract

Metal-free and dihydroxysilicon derivatives of liquid crystalline tetrakis(4',5'-bisdecoxy-benzo-18-crown-6)phthalocyanine are prepared which is liquid crystalline and in chloroform accumulate to yield a gel. In the gel, the network fibers are made up of parallel strands of supermolecules and formed through self-assembly of about 10 to the fourth power molecules. The strands are characterized as molecular cables constituting a central electron wire, four ion channels and an encompassing insulating hydrocarbon mantle.
